|
@@ -7,6 +7,7 @@ import (
|
|
"database/sql"
|
|
"database/sql"
|
|
"encoding/base64"
|
|
"encoding/base64"
|
|
"fmt"
|
|
"fmt"
|
|
|
|
+ "go.mongodb.org/mongo-driver/bson"
|
|
"jy/src/jfw/modules/subscribepay/src/config"
|
|
"jy/src/jfw/modules/subscribepay/src/config"
|
|
"jy/src/jfw/modules/subscribepay/src/entity"
|
|
"jy/src/jfw/modules/subscribepay/src/entity"
|
|
"jy/src/jfw/modules/subscribepay/src/util"
|
|
"jy/src/jfw/modules/subscribepay/src/util"
|
|
@@ -340,10 +341,9 @@ func (this *UserAccount) GetAccountInfo() {
|
|
}
|
|
}
|
|
}
|
|
}
|
|
reportMail := ""
|
|
reportMail := ""
|
|
- orders1 := util.Mysql.SelectBySql(`SELECT user_mail from dataexport_order where user_id=? and order_status=1 and (product_type='投标企业信用报告' or product_type='企业中标分析报告下载包' or product_type='业主采购分析报告下载包' or
|
|
|
|
- product_type = '市场分析定制报告下载包') order by create_time desc limit 1`, qutil.ObjToString(sessVal["userId"]))
|
|
|
|
- if orders1 != nil && len(*orders1) == 1 {
|
|
|
|
- reportMail = qutil.ObjToString((*orders1)[0]["user_mail"])
|
|
|
|
|
|
+ record, _ := util.MQFW.Find("analysis_report_screen", bson.M{"s_userId": qutil.ObjToString(sessVal["userId"])}, bson.M{"l_createTime": -1}, bson.M{"s_email": 1}, true, -1, -1)
|
|
|
|
+ if record != nil && len(*record) > 0 {
|
|
|
|
+ reportMail = qutil.ObjToString((*record)[0]["s_email"])
|
|
}
|
|
}
|
|
if reportMail == "" {
|
|
if reportMail == "" {
|
|
reportMail = qutil.ObjToString((*userMsg)["s_myemail"])
|
|
reportMail = qutil.ObjToString((*userMsg)["s_myemail"])
|